Bathroom Remodel Permit Requirements in Aurora, CO
Uses 2021 I-Codes with local amendments (Aurora Municipal Code Ch. 22). High altitude (5,471 ft), HVAC derating required. Spans Arapahoe, Adams, and Douglas counties. Aurora4Biz portal for permits. Flat-rate permits available for simple jobs. Email: permitcounter@auroragov.org

When you don’t need a Bathroom permit in Aurora
Cosmetic bathroom renovations do not require a permit.
When you need a Bathroom permit in Aurora
Moving plumbing requires permits.
Adding a new bathroom requires permits.
Bathroom wall removal requires a permit.

Bathroom Remodel Permit Costs: Aurora vs. Nearby
Aurora's fees are right in line with the Colorado average, $135 – $900 versus $142 – $471 statewide.
| City | Estimated Fee |
|---|---|
| Aurora | $135 – $900 |
| Denver | $150 – $1,000 |
| Colorado Springs | $50 – $1,000 |
| Fort Collins | $50 – $1,000 |

Zoning & HOA Considerations
If you live in an HOA community: interior bathroom remodels rarely require HOA approval. However, if the work involves exterior changes (new vents, windows, or plumbing cleanouts), check your CC&Rs first.
